I was on a trip with friends, yes, I have friends, to the island of Boracay. We just arrived at Caticlan and we were on our way to the actual island itself. There is no airport on the island of Boracay itself since it is very small, the nearest airport is accessible by boat. Most hotels would provide some sort of service to fetch visitors from the airport, for independent travelers, there is always the kiosks are the airport terminal who can provide this service for you. Our resort, Henann Resorts has a private pick up service for us and they even have their own private port for us to depart from. I like how they didn’t build a physical port but instead built a pontoon where people will just walk to the boat. I disliked how it used to be back then where boats will just park wherever they want and just drop anchor wherever destroying whatever is below.

Because Henann is a high end resort, the boats here are much better than the old outrigger canoes that are actually still in use right now. The Henann boats appear to be much more comfortable, not to mention that they are faster. It only takes a few minutes to get to the port on Boracay Island at the village of Cagban. I was surprised and pleased to know that there is a proper port for visitors now. It used to be that the outrigger canoes would just park at the main beach itself and hopefully avoid any swimmers that are in the way. Most visitors will not be staying at Cagban village but instead they will have to find local transport to their hotels. For us, however, Henann has got us covered. They have shuttle buses on the mainland and they also have shuttle buses on the resort island itself so visitors will just keep riding until we get to the hotel.
